11. Vitamin C

Vitamin C is well known for supporting the immune system, mainly through its role as an antioxidant to manage oxidative stress. It also supports the nervous system by helping to regulate energy metabolism in neurons.

Although the body doesn’t store vitamin C in large quantities compared to some other nutrients, there is an exception to this rule when it comes to the adrenal glands. These glands store a substantial amount of vitamin C. This supply of vitamin C in the adrenal glands assists in maintaining the glands’ normal functions, which include responding to stress and producing cortisol.

Antioxidants play an important role in fertility. Vitamin C supplementation has been shown to help increase progesterone levels in women with reduced levels during their luteal phase of the menstrual cycle. Adequate progesterone is needed for a healthy menstrual cycle and pregnancy. In fact, lower concentrations of antioxidants in the body are associated with the potential for increased risk of reproductive issues. Reproductive hormone production is sensitive to oxidative stress, so antioxidants like vitamin C and others can help restore balance.

Food sources of vitamin C include citrus, peppers, broccoli, Brussels sprouts, kiwis, and strawberries. 12. Shatavari

Shatavari is actually a species of asparagus that packs a powerful punch. It may be able to support healthy menstruation and help with common symptoms of PMS. Due to shatavari’s antioxidant and adaptogenic properties, it may improve reproductive health through mediating the stress response.
